What is a Portable Running Machine?
A portable running machine is a compact treadmill designed for easy transportation and storage. Unlike traditional treadmills, which can take up a significant amount of space and may require special setups, portable running machines are typically light-weight, foldable, and equipped with wheels for simple movement. They can be used in a range of settings, from home fitness centers to outside spaces, making them a hassle-free choice for people seeking to include facing their everyday routines.
Key Features of Portable Running Machines
- Size and Weight: Most portable running machines weigh in between 50 to 100 pounds and can quickly fit in little areas such as homes or workplaces.
- Foldability: Many models include a folding style that permits users to collapse the machine when not in use, more reducing the storage area needed.
- Digital Display: Most portable treadmills featured digital display screens that provide essential exercise metrics, including speed, range, calories burned, and heart rate.
- Speed Settings: These machines often offer adjustable speed settings to accommodate different exercise intensities, from walking to running.
- Security Features: Many portable running machines are geared up with security functions, such as automated shut-off mechanisms, emergency stop buttons, and non-slip surface areas.

How to Choose the Right Portable Running Machine
Choosing the ideal portable running machine needs mindful consideration of different aspects. Here are some crucial elements to bear in mind while purchasing one:
Feature | Description |
---|---|
Motor Power | Try to find machines with at least 1.5 HP for smoother running experience. |
Running Surface | Consider the length and width of the running belt; a larger surface is generally more comfortable. |
Weight Capacity | Inspect the maximum weight limit to guarantee it accommodates all users. |
Slope Options | Some models use adjustable slope settings for increased workout strength. |
Price | Discover a model that fits within your spending plan while still fulfilling your requirements. |
FAQs About Portable Running Machines
Are portable running machines ideal for newbies?
- Yes, lots of portable running machines use adjustable speeds and functions, making them ideal for newbies and advanced users alike.
How do I preserve my portable running machine?
- Frequently lube the belt, keep it tidy, and occasionally look for any loose screws or worn parts to maintain optimum efficiency.
Can I use a portable running machine outdoors?
- While many portable running machines are created for indoor use, some designs may be suitable for outside settings, depending on their build and materials.
What is the typical life expectancy of a portable running machine?
- The life-span can vary considerably based upon the design and how well it's kept, however common portable running machines last in between 5 to 10 years with proper care.
Can I utilize a portable running machine for walking and running?
- Definitely! Portable running machines are flexible and can be used for walking, running, and performing at varying strengths.
